Shane Lowry has made a solid start to the BMW PGA Championship at Wentworth.

The Offaly man has carded a 68 in his opening round to sit on 4-under, two shots off the lead.

Consecutive bogeys on the 8th and 9th holes were the only blemish on his opening day's efforts as he managed six birdies in all, with three in a row on the 10th, 11th and 12th holes.

Sweden's Johan Carlsson leads the way on 6-under after carding a 66.

He holds a one shot lead over a three way tie for second made up of Italy's Francesco Molinari, Scotland's Scott Jamieson and Thailand's Kiradech Aphibarnrat.

Lowry is one shot behind that group alongside English golfer Graeme Storm, who won the BMW South Africa Open earlier this year by beating Rory McIlroy in a playoff, and South Africa's Branden Grace among others.

The other Irish in action are Damien McGrane who is on 1-under at present, while three time major winner Padraig Harrington carded a 73 to sit out 1-over. The Dubliner's low point came with a double bogey on the 17th, although he did manage three birdies in a tournament that is seeing him ease back into action following neck surgery.

Darren Clarke is also on 1-over.
